Air Disinfection and Purification Machine market size was valued at USD 10937.0 million in 2022 and is expected to expand at a CAGR of 8.61% during the forecast period, reaching USD 23003.94 million by 2031.

Air Disinfection and Purification Machine MARKET SEGMENTATION
The air disinfection and purification machine market is segmented based on various factors such as technology, type, application, and region. Understanding these segments is crucial for stakeholders to identify focus areas and potential markets.
- Technology:
- "HEPA Technology (High-Efficiency Particulate Air):" Widely recognized for its ability to remove 99.97% of particles as small as 0.3 microns. It's a dominant segment due to its high efficiency, particularly in healthcare settings and regions with high pollution levels.
- "Activated Carbon Technology:" Effective in removing odors, gases, and VOCs. It's essential for industrial applications or areas with high chemical pollutants.
- "UV-C Light:" Utilizes ultraviolet light to kill or inactivate microorganisms, making it popular in hospital settings and places requiring sterile environments.
- "Negative Ion:" Releases negatively charged ions that attract positively charged airborne particles, making them too heavy to remain airborne. It's beneficial for allergy sufferers.
- "Ozone Generators:" Though effective at disinfecting air, they're controversial due to concerns about ozone being a lung irritant. Usage is more common in commercial or industrial settings.
- "Electrostatic Precipitators:" Trap airborne particulates using electrostatic charge. Key for environments with heavy dust or smoke.
- Type:
- "Portable Units:" Preferred for residential use due to their convenience and mobility. They're suitable for small to medium-sized rooms.
- "Whole-House Units:" Integrated into the HVAC system of a building, these purifiers maintain air quality throughout the premises. They're popular in commercial buildings and large residences.
- "Commercial Units:" Specifically designed for commercial spaces, these have higher capacities and more robust filtration systems to handle larger spaces with more contaminants.
- Application:
- "Residential:" Increased demand due to rising health awareness among consumers, especially concerning indoor air quality and its impact on conditions such as asthma and allergies.
- "Commercial:" Includes office buildings, shopping centers, hotels, and restaurants. The focus is on maintaining a healthy indoor environment for both employees and customers.
- "Industrial:" Used in manufacturing facilities, warehouses, and plants to protect workers from industrial pollutants and ensure compliance with health and safety regulations.
- "Healthcare:" Critical segment due to the need for sterile environments in areas such as operating rooms, patient wards, and laboratories.
